Fabian Ruiz risks being thrown on the bench as renewal talks with Napoli end in disaster

Fabian Ruiz’s future at Napoli is seemingly over, with the latest edition of updates concerning the saga witnessing the player’s ultimate rejection of the extension offered by the Partenopei.

According to a report from La Gazzetta dello Sport, Fabian Ruiz, who has eventually rebuffed Napoli’s latest contract renewal offer, could experience the same treatment from the club as Arkadiusz Milik did two years ago.

Having opted against penning a new deal for the Naples-based club, Milik ended up being excluded from Napoli’s official Serie A and UEFA Europa League squads. Going down the same path, Ruiz could also run into the same predicament next season.

The Spaniard’s current terms with Napoli expire in June 2023, meaning that he could leave the club for free next summer if the player doesn’t agree to a contract extension.

The former Real Betis star, as reported before, has always dreamt of playing for top clubs in Spain, including those like Real Madrid and Atletico Madrid.

Although there is interest from them in the 26-year-old midfielder, it is unlikely that any of those two teams will offer a contract to the player this summer. Napoli are striving to bind David Ospina and Dries Mertens with renewals, but the negotiations have not reported reached their goals.
